Meat Ants

 

Meat ants are native to Australia and are mostly found in country areas. They are very territorial and if they are interfered with they become very aggressive. When their colony’s territory is invaded large numbers of meat ants rush out of the nest to defend themselves and their territory. These ants bite, they do not sting. They generally build their colonies in large open areas like paddocks and dirt tracks that have a top layer of soil. Meat ants main food source is animal materials and honeydew. They have a strong odor when crushed and are about 13-14mm long. They are red and black in colour.
